Uso di script per form dati

La funzionalità Script permette di visualizzare, modificare e stampare lo script. La sintassi deve essere inserita nella casella di testo della pagina Script.

È possibile utilizzare tre tipi di elementi sintattici nella creazione di script form dati: parole chiave, valori e opzioni. Le parole chiave si trovano su singole righe nello script e sono collocate sulla sinistra del segno uguale. I valori sono collocati immediatamente dopo il segno uguale per completare la riga. Le opzioni possono essere aggiunte ad una riga dello script e devono essere separate da una virgola.

Nota:

Quando è obbligatorio un valore, è necessario specificarlo prima delle opzioni. Le opzioni non sono mai richieste e possono assumere un ordine qualsiasi.

Quando si installa Applicazioni di esempio per Oracle Hyperion Financial Management vengono installati script di form dati di esempio. I file si trovano nella cartella Sample Applications della directory in cui è stato installato Financial Management.

Nota:

Gli elementi degli script form immissione dati non rilevano la distinzione fra maiuscole e minuscole.

Tabella 7-1 Sintassi degli script form dati

Sintassi degli script Descrizione

AddMember

In una definizione righe consente all'utente di aggiungere i dati per un membro precedentemente soppresso dal form perché privo di dati o perché contenente degli zeri. L'opzione aggiunge un'icona al form che, quando si fa clic su di essa, permette all'utente di selezionare i membri da aggiungere al form.

BackgroundPOV

Consente di specificare i membri dimensione sfondo per il form.

Blank

Consente di inserire una riga, una colonna o una cella vuota nel form.

Cn

Consente di definire ogni colonna in un form.

CalcByRow

Consente di specificare se deve essere usato il calcolo riga quando una cella presenta un calcolo colonna intersecante.

Cell_Link

Con Collegamento una definizione righe, consente di creare un collegamento a un altro form inserimento dati.

CellText

Consente di specificare se la riga o la colonna accetta input di testo di cella.

CustomHeader

Consente di specificare testo di intestazione custom da visualizzare al posto dell'etichetta o della descrizione del membro. Da utilizzare in una definizione righe o colonne.

Non è possibile utilizzare queste parole chiave per le intestazioni custom:

  • <pre>

  • <textarea>

  • <script>

  • <javascript>

  • <jscript>

  • <vbs>

  • <vbscript>

  • stringhe quali <XonX=X>, dove X = qualsiasi stringa

CustomHeaderStyle

Consente di assegnare attributi stile custom ad un'intestazione riga o colonna.

DynamicPOV

Obsoleto. Non utilizzare.

FormInputBoxLength

Consente di specificare la larghezza della casella di input nel form.

FormNumDecimals

Consente di specificare il numero di cifre decimali nel form. Questa parola chiave si sostituisce alle impostazioni decimali per la valuta della cella. Utilizzare NumDecimals per sostituire queste impostazioni per una riga, colonna o cella.

FormRowHeight

Consente di specificare l'altezza di tutte le righe nel form.

FormScale

Consente di specificare la scala del form.

HeaderOption

Consente di specificare il modo di visualizzare le intestazioni dimensione nel form. Mostra le etichette e/o le descrizioni, imposta gli attributi stile, imposta la larghezza massima o fissa.

Instructions

Consente di creare istruzioni in un testo con formattazione HTML e nei collegamenti.

LineItemDetailSinglePeriod

Consente di specificare se i dettagli di elemento riga devono essere visualizzati solo per la cella selezionata o per tutti i periodi.

Collegamento

Utilizzare Cell_Link per creare un collegamento a un altro form inserimento dati.

MaxCells

Consente di specificare il numero massimo di celle per un form di dati.

MaxColsForSparseRetrievalMethod

Consente di ottimizzare la performance di form sparsi. Da utilizzare con form che contengono più di 10 colonne.

NoSuppress

Consente di disattivare la soppressione di una o più righe o colonne. Questa impostazione si sostituisce alle altre impostazioni di soppressione nel form: SuppressInvalidRows, SuppressNoDataRows, SuppressZeroRows, SuppressInvalidCols, SuppressNoDataCols, SuppressZeroCols.

NumDecimals

Consente di specificare il numero di posizioni decimali per una riga, una colonna o una cella. Questa parola chiave si sostituisce alle impostazioni decimali per la valuta della cella e alle impostazioni decimali del form FormNumDecimals.

OnDemandRules

Consente di specificare quali regole su richiesta sono disponibili nel form dati.

Override

Consente di specificare un POV o un calcolo differenti per una o più righe o colonne, per aggiungere attributi stile o per impostare la scala. Da utilizzare in una definizione righe o colonne.

HideInPov

Consente di specificare se nascondere la dimensione nel punto di vista.

POVOrder

Consente di specificare l'ordine dei nomi dimensione nel punto di vista.

PrintNumDataColsPerPage

Consente di specificare il numero di colonne da stampare su ogni pagina.

PrintNumRowsPerPage

Consente di specificare il numero di righe da stampare su ogni pagina.

PrintRepeatHeadersonAllPages

Consente di stampare le intestazioni su ogni pagina.

Rn

Consente di definire ogni riga di un form.

ReadOnly

Consente di specificare le righe, colonne o celle di sola lettura.

ReportDescription

Consente di specificare la descrizione del form.

La descrizione non può contenere e commerciali (&).

ReportLabel

Consente di specificare l'etichetta del form. I caratteri seguenti non sono supportati per le etichette form dati:

E commerciale (&), asterisco (*), barra rovesciata (\), due punti (:), virgola (,), parentesi graffe ({ } ), virgolette doppie (""), barra (/), minore di e maggiore di (< >), simbolo di numero (#), parentesi ( ), periodo (.), barra verticale (|), segno più (+), punto interrogativo (?), punto e virgola (;) e sottolineatura (_).

ReportSecurityClass

Consente di specificare la classe di protezione del form.

ReportType

Consente di impostare il tipo di form. Il valore deve essere impostato su WebForm.

RowHeaderPct

Consente di ridimensionare la larghezza dell'intestazione della riga rispetto alla larghezza totale del form.

SCalc

Consente di specificare i calcoli lato server per una riga, una colonna o una cella.

Scale

Consente di specificare la scala per una riga, una colonna o una cella. I valori validi sono compresi tra -12 e 12. Questa impostazione si sostituisce all'impostazione scala del form. Fare riferimento a FormScale.

SelectablePOVList

Consente di specificare i membri dimensione selezionabili nel form.

ShowDescriptions

Consente di mostrare le descrizioni dei membri dimensione.

ShowLabels

Consente di mostrare le etichette dei membri dimensione.

String

Consente di aggiungere una stringa di testo ad una colonna, riga o cella.

Style

Consente di specificare gli attributi stile per un'intestazione riga, colonna, cella o dimensione.

SuppressColHeaderRepeats

Consente di impedire la visualizzazione di intestazioni colonne ripetute.

SuppressInvalidCols

Consente di impedire la visualizzazione di celle non valide nelle colonne.

SuppressInvalidRows

Consente di impedire la visualizzazione di celle non valide nelle righe.

SuppressNoDataCols

Consente di impedire la visualizzazione di colonne prive di dati.

SuppressNoDataRows

Consente di impedire la visualizzazione di righe prive di dati.

SuppressRowHeaderRepeats

Consente di impedire la visualizzazione di intestazioni righe ripetute.

SuppressZeroCols

Consente di impedire la visualizzazione di colonne con zeri.

SuppressZeroRows

Consente di impedire la visualizzazione di righe con zeri.